PreviewPro
Inspiration
The inspiration behind PreviewPro stems from the need for a streamlined and efficient process for previewing web applications during the development phase. Recognizing the importance of timely feedback and seamless collaboration, we set out to create a solution that simplifies the review process for developers and enhances the overall development experience.
Key Features
GitLab Pages Integration: Utilizing GitLab Pages, PreviewPro automatically deploys preview environments for each merge request, enabling developers and reviewers to visualize changes in real-time.
Support for Multiple Frameworks: While currently optimized for React applications, PreviewPro is designed to expand its support to other frameworks in the future, including Vue.js, Angular, and more. This ensures compatibility and flexibility across various development stacks.
Easy Setup: With PreviewPro, setup is a breeze. Our intuitive configuration process allows users to deploy the CI/CD pipeline within minutes, eliminating the need for complex configurations and reducing setup time.
How It Works
Simply integrate PreviewPro's GitLab CI/CD pipeline into your React project, and watch as it automates the build and deployment process effortlessly. With each merge request, GitLab Pages generates a preview environment, allowing both developers and reviewers to visualize changes instantly. Gone are the days of manual deployment and tedious configuration.
What's next for PreviewPro
As we look to the future, our vision for PreviewPro extends beyond React applications. We are committed to expanding our support to encompass a wider range of frameworks and technologies, ensuring that developers across various domains can benefit from our streamlined CI/CD pipeline. Our roadmap includes adding support for popular frameworks such as Vue.js, Angular, and beyond, as well as incorporating additional features to further enhance the development workflow.
Impact it has on GitLab users
PreviewPro fundamentally transforms the way GitLab users approach development and collaboration. By automating the build and deployment process and providing instant previews for every merge request, PreviewPro significantly reduces the time and effort required for code review and testing. This not only accelerates the development cycle but also fosters greater collaboration among team members. With PreviewPro, GitLab users can expect to experience increased productivity, improved code quality, and enhanced collaboration throughout the development lifecycle.
Built With
- gitlab
Log in or sign up for Devpost to join the conversation.